strerror: should live in string.h according to the standards
authorAlan Cox <alan@linux.intel.com>
Wed, 20 May 2015 22:36:56 +0000 (23:36 +0100)
committerAlan Cox <alan@linux.intel.com>
Wed, 20 May 2015 22:36:56 +0000 (23:36 +0100)
Library/include/stdio.h
Library/include/string.h

index 91197dd..226c17a 100644 (file)
@@ -146,7 +146,6 @@ extern int vfscanf __P((FILE*, const char*, va_list));
 extern int vsscanf __P((char*, const char*, va_list));
 
 extern void perror __P((const char *__s));
-extern char *strerror __P((int __errno));
 
 extern char *tmpnam __P((char *buf));
 
index bf7d269..84a458a 100644 (file)
@@ -60,6 +60,7 @@ extern size_t strxfrm __P((char *, const char *, size_t));
 extern int strcoll __P((const char *s1, const char *s2));
 
 extern const char *strsignal __P((int s));
+extern char *strerror __P((int __errno));
 
 #ifdef z80
 #pagma inline(memcpy)